About

I.V. Krivtsun is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Ocean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, I.V. Krivtsun has authored 60 papers receiving a total of 371 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 42 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 19 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 18 papers in Ocean Engineering. Recurrent topics in I.V. Krivtsun’s work include Welding Techniques and Residual Stresses (34 papers), Engineering and Environmental Studies (17 papers) and Vacuum and Plasma Arcs (13 papers). I.V. Krivtsun is often cited by papers focused on Welding Techniques and Residual Stresses (34 papers), Engineering and Environmental Studies (17 papers) and Vacuum and Plasma Arcs (13 papers). I.V. Krivtsun collaborates with scholars based in Ukraine, Germany and China. I.V. Krivtsun's co-authors include Uwe Reisgen, Volodymyr Korzhyk, А. G. Zagorodny, Oleg Mokrov, V.L. Demchenko, О. Б. Ковалев, I. P. Gulyaev, A. Dolmatov, Yu. S. Borisov and Д. В. Коваленко and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Physics D Applied Physics, Polymers and Physics of Plasmas.
